Victoria Clark

She's a Tony Award Winning Broadway Star but she is also a superstar Beacon parent. Lucky for B'DAT, her son was willing to share!

Light In the Piazza Production Archive

Sings Like an Angel, and Makes a Kickin Banana Bread!

Picture
Victoria Clark was starring in The Light in the Piazza at Lincoln Center when B'DAT was producing Pippin around the corner. We first met her when she tip toed into the back of the drama studio to see her voice student sing his heart out playing the title role.

Little did Beacon know that the nice lady grinning in the back of the house would return both with her son as an incoming freshman a few years later, but also as a guest performer with our choir, guest teaching artist, mentor and friend. So generous. So kind. She sang with our choir and helped up our game!

Victoria Clark convinced our director that we could handle, Light in the Piazza, harp and all, and then she helped us every step of the way. Musically her input and support was immeasurable, but she also was perhaps the very best cheerleader of the whole season. Never empty handed, she delivered cookies, brownies and always perfectly timed words of encouragement for everyone involved with the production. Her unwavering faith and support of our program is an inspiration.
